H3: Functional Enhancements
- Moisture Resistance: PE liners (80–120 GSM) reduce permeability to <1.5g/m²/day (ASTM E96), critical for hygroscopic products like fertilizers.
- UV Stabilization: BOPP films (15–25μm) block 90% of UV-B rays, extending outdoor storage life by 6–8 months.
H2: Production Process and Quality Assurance
VidePak’s manufacturing ecosystem combines Starlinger’s circular looms and W&H extrusion lines to ensure precision at every stage:
Stage | Key Process | Quality Control |
---|---|---|
Extrusion | PP resin melted into 0.04–0.06mm tapes | Laser sensors ensure ±0.005mm thickness |
Weaving | 12–14 strands per inch (SPI) density | AI cameras detect defects with 99.7% accuracy |
Lamination | PE/BOPP coatings applied (0.08–0.12mm) | ASTM D903 peel tests validate ≥3N/cm adhesion |
Printing | 8-color flexographic printing | Spectrophotometers ensure ±2% color accuracy |
